Wisconsin Blogger Shows Oregon Some Love
May 12, 2008

Wisconsin blogger Ladyhawker recently showed Oregon some love by writing about her visits to Ecola State Park, the Columbia River Gorge and Portland. Ladyhawker (also known as Carolyn) began writing about her Oregon adventure as soon as she arrived in the Portland airport. She visited tidepools and Haystack Rock on the Oregon Coast, the Rhododendron Gardens in Portland and Multnomah Falls. Be sure to check out her photos (especially of all the flowers and waterfalls), as they are stunning. You will even see a photograph of the Oregon Scenic Byways Guide!
